fre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

c語言基本運算符與表達(dá)式-資料下載頁

2025-07-25 18:09本頁面
  

【正文】 ?說明: – 不能用于常量和表達(dá)式 ,如 5++, (a+b)++ – 結(jié)合方向: 自右向左 – 優(yōu)先級: ++ * / % + 例 i++ ? (i++) i=3。 printf(“%d”,i++)。 //3 例 int a=5,b。 b=a++。 printf(“a=%d,b=%d”,a,b)。 //a=6,b=5 例 int a=5,b。 b=++a。 printf(“a=%d,b=%d”,a,b)。 //a=6,b=6 例 9: include”” main() { int x,y,z。 x=y=8。z=++x。 printf(“\n%3d%3d%3d”,y,z,x)。 x=y=8。z=x++。 printf(“\n%3d%3d%3d”,y,z,x)。 x=y=8。z=x。 printf(“\n%3d%3d%3d”,y,z,x)。 x=y=8。z=x。 printf(“\n%3d%3d%3d”,y,z,x)。 printf(“\n”)。 } 結(jié)果: 8 9 9 8 8 9 8 7 7 8 8 7 逗號運算符和表達(dá)式 ? 形式: 表達(dá)式 1,表達(dá)式 2,…… ,表達(dá)式 n ? 結(jié)合性 :從左向右 ? 優(yōu)先級 : 最低 ? 表達(dá)式 值:等于表達(dá)式 n的值 ? 用途: 常用于循環(huán) for語句中 例 a=3*5,a*4 a=3*5,a*4,a+5 例 a=1。b=2。c=3。 printf(“%d,%d,%d”,a,b,c)。 printf(“%d,%d,%d”,(a,b,c),b,c)。 //a=15,表達(dá)式值 60 //a=15,表達(dá)式值 20 //1,2,3 //3,2,3 例 10: include”” main() { int x,y=7。 float z=4。 x=(y=y+6,y/z)。 printf(x=%d\n,x)。 } 運行結(jié)果: x=3 條件運算符與表達(dá)式 ? e1 ? e2 : e3 (唯一的三目運算符) ?功能: e1為真,取 e2值; e1為假,取 e3值。 (相當(dāng)于條件語句,但不能取代一般 if語句) ? 結(jié)合方向: 自右向左 如 ab?a:cd?c:d ? ab?a:(cd?c:d) 例 if (ab) printf(“%d”,a)。 else printf(“%d”,b)。 printf(“%d”,ab?a:b)。 例 求 a+|b| printf(“a+|b|=%d\n”,b0?a+b:ab)。 例 (a==b)??Y?:?N? (x%2==1)?1:0 (x=0)?x:x (c=?a? amp。amp。 c=?z?)?c?a?+?A?:c 求字節(jié)運算符 sizeof ?單目運算符 ?作用:返回變量或類型的字節(jié)長度 。 ?一般形式為: sizeof(變量或類型 ) 如 : sizeof(double) 為 8 sizeof(int) 為 2 也可以求已定義的變量 , 例如 : float f。 int i。 i=sizeof(f)。 則 i的值將為 4。 例 11: include”” include main() { printf(“\n char:%5d byte,sizeof(char))。 printf(“\n int:%5d bytes,sizeof(int))。 printf(“\n long:%5d byte,sizeof(long))。 printf(“\n float:%5d byte,sizeof(float))。 } 運行結(jié)果: char 1 byte Int 2 bytes long 4 bytes float 4 byte
點擊復(fù)制文檔內(nèi)容
范文總結(jié)相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1